Varieties of Outdoor Heaters

Outdoor heaters come in many forms. The most popular are gas heaters, which provide intense heat and are perfect for larger areas. We can also choose electric heaters, which are easy to use and simply need to be plugged in. Another option to consider is infrared heaters, which radiate heat in a targeted manner, creating a cozy atmosphere regardless of the weather conditions.

Choosing the Right Heater

Choosing the perfect outdoor heater can seem daunting, but the key is to determine your intended use. If you plan to host large gatherings, opt for a larger gas model. For smaller spaces, a compact electric heater will do just fine. Consider also the location where you’ll be using it—some models are more suitable for indoor use, while others are designed specifically for the outdoors.

Outdoor Heaters and Safety

Safety is a crucial aspect of using outdoor heaters. With gas heaters, special attention should be paid to ventilation and maintaining a safe distance from flammable materials. For electric heaters, ensuring the quality of the power cords and the condition of the unit is essential to avoid electric shock risks.

Setting Up and Using Heaters

When using outdoor heaters, it’s vital to connect and operate them correctly. With gas heaters, check that the installation is secure and that no leaks are present. Always monitor their usage and adhere to safety guidelines. Electric units only need to be plugged in, but ensure that the cord doesn’t come into contact with water.

Caring for Outdoor Heaters

Proper maintenance of outdoor heaters will prolong their lifespan and efficiency. For gas models, ensure the outlets are clean. For electric heaters, keep the unit clean and regularly inspect the power cords for wear. By taking care of your devices, you can avoid malfunctions and enjoy the warmth for many seasons to come.
